This was the first CD released by Adriano and it was recorded in 1992.

I had the privilege to play and tour with Adriano in 1984, just before I migrated to Australia, and, more recently in August 2001 when we played with Periquito - Sax, Felipe Baden-Powell - Piano and Alexandre Carvalho - Guitar. Adriano and I remained good friends despite the distance and I always get his CD's as a present when I go to Rio !!) I remember being in Rio in 1990 and watching Adriano rehearsing with his band at his place in Tijuca. I was amazed by the music they were producing !!!

Adriano did the whole lot in this album: he composed, arranged, and playedAdriano Giffoni & Carlos Ferreira - Rio, August 2001 in all the tracks. His superb and unique mastery of the Bass is showcased in Bom Partido where Adriano play all parts (rhythm & solo) on bass. He plays the REAL Brazilian feel - "Brazuca pura" !! . The arrangements of both Samba de Candango and Arte Final are both rich rhythmically and exciting (check out Adriano's bass intro on the former - wow !!). Adriano solo on Bom Dia Mar is so beautiful that makes me reminisce of the old days I spent in Ipanema looking at the sunset, sigh! Marimbanda is another example of the wealth of the Brazilian music styles. Modelo de Suingue is a very sweet melody which, believe me, you never should listen to when you're heart broken. Click here to buy this great CD!!Keeping the tradition in this second album, Adriano arranged/composed(*)/ played in all tracks. Adriano plays a multitude of Brazilian rhythms (Samba, Partido Alto, Afoxe, Baiao, Maracatu) and even a blues - Brazilian Style - dedicated to Luis Carlos Antunes (our mutual friend who was running a Jazz program at Fluminense FM at the time I left Brazil).

This album got good write-ups from two top Brazilian artists: Leny de Andrade & Joao Nogueira.

"Congratulations to both Adriano Giffoni and Perfil Musical for this special and very Brazilian album. The good taste of his first CD permeates through this second one. Madrugada Carioca has everything I like: talent, guts, power and light. Light of a special Bass that produces continuously the Good, the Beautiful and the Right, as far as Brazilian music is concerned. A album for the world ! That's the way !!! Good luck !"
Leny de Andrade

"Adriano Gifoni, Brazilian musician ... and what a musician ! From all the musicians I've ever worked with, Giffoni is one that touched me the most for the quality, sound and professionalism he steers his career with. Madrugada Carioca shows us how good this "cearense" from Quixada City is."
Joao Nogueira

(*) except tracks O Sol Nascera and Livia
